
About this Dog
Ruby is a sweet cavalier looking for an experienced patient family that speaks 'dog'. Ruby is a breeder release from a commercial facility. She hasn't had the benefit a dog her age might have who was born in a home. That being said, while she is scared and timid, once she feels safe she is longing to bond with a family. She will likely always be timid. She needs family who will help her slowly decompress and adjust in her own time. Sally is a friendly gentle gal. She needs a fenced in yard for her potty place. She doesn't understand leash walking. Cavaliers tend to be Velcro dogs. They want to be close to a human, Ruby is friendly, wags her tail and then retreats, She wants to be cared for, She needs to relax enough to know she can move forward without fear, She needs a patient adopter without expectations she will change but will give her the time to allow her to if she chooses, Like all dogs, she will need structure and a patient, loving home. We recommend training for all dogs, not only to give Ruby important learning skills, but because you and your dog will create a stronger bond just by going through the training together. Ruby is fully vetted. She has been spayed, received age-appropriate vaccines, and is microchipped. Subsequent vaccines will be at the expense of her adopter. Her adoption fee is $1200..00. She is on the hunt for her own completely committed family. Little dogs can live to be 20+ years old, so Sally wants to be sure her family is all in for better or for worse!
